Mifos X安装全攻略:Tomcat、MySQL与SSL问题解析

需积分: 9 2 下载量 67 浏览量 更新于2024-09-13 收藏 172KB DOCX 举报
"Mifos X安装过程中的常见问题与解决方案" 在安装Mifos X时,可能会遇到多种技术性问题,主要包括Tomcat服务器的安装、MySQL数据库的设置以及SSL安全证书的配置。以下是对这些问题的详细解答: 1. **Tomcat安装问题**: Tomcat有两种形式,安装版和解压缩版。安装版提供了图形化的安装界面,启动服务通常更为便捷,而解压缩版则需要手动执行`startup.bat`脚本来启动服务。`tomcat7.exe`是一个可执行文件,用于启动已作为服务安装的Tomcat,它依赖于系统服务配置的JAVA环境。相比之下,`startup.bat`是一个批处理文件,允许直接在命令行下启动Tomcat,并且可以独立配置JAVA_HOME和JRE_HOME环境变量。如果遇到启动问题,检查相关环境变量设置,确保JAVA_HOME指向正确的Java SDK路径。 2. **MySQL安装问题**: MySQL安装时需设定root用户的初始密码,务必记住这个密码,因为后续的数据库连接需要用到。在导入SQL文件时,确保提供文件的完整路径和.sql扩展名,否则MySQL可能无法识别。首次启动MySQL服务时,可能出现无法连接的问题,此时可以尝试重启服务以解决连接问题。 3. **SSL密钥问题**: 创建SSL密钥时,系统通常会默认将其保存在用户主目录下,例如"C:\Users\Administrator\.keystore"。要修改服务器配置以启用SSL,需要找到并编辑`server.xml`文件,确保引用了正确的密钥存储路径。SSL提供了一种安全的数据传输方式,通过HTTPS协议,确保数据在传输过程中被加密,防止中间人攻击。浏览器地址栏显示的锁型图标是HTTPS安全连接的标志,点击可查看站点的认证信息。 4. **HTTP与HTTPS的区别**: HTTP(超文本传输协议)是互联网上应用最广泛的一种网络协议,它不提供数据的加密,因此数据在传输过程中可能被窃取。而HTTPS(安全套接层超文本传输协议)是在HTTP基础上增加了SSL/TLS协议,提供了对网络连接的安全保护,包括数据的加密、服务器身份的验证以及消息完整性检查。URL上,HTTP以"http://"开头,HTTPS以"https://"开头,后者表明数据传输受到加密保护。 在解决Mifos X的安装问题时,了解这些基础知识非常重要。如果遇到困难,可以检查配置文件、日志文件或在线搜索解决方案,大多数问题都有详细的解答步骤。对于复杂的问题,寻求专业社区或开发者论坛的帮助也是个不错的选择。
2016-07-22 上传